Cleburne became the Johnson County seat in 1867, and in 1869 the Grand Lodge of Texas granted a charter to Cleburne Masonic Lodge No. 315. Its members built a lodge hall in March 1871, and the town of Cleburne was officially chartered two months later. Early lodge members who were influential in the town's development included B.J. Chambers, Jeremiah Easterwood, N.H. Cook, J.A. Willingham, B.S. Greenshaw, B.F. Clayton, and Charles W. Breech. Several Cleburne mayors and county and state judges have belonged to the lodge, whose financial outreach and community activities center on educational efforts.
